Career path

Career Role Description
Paralegal (Criminal Law) Assist solicitors with case preparation, legal research, and client communication in criminal proceedings. High demand for meticulous and detail-oriented individuals.
Legal Executive (Criminal Law) Handle aspects of criminal cases independently, including client management, document drafting and court appearances. Requires experience and strong legal knowledge.
Police Investigator Investigate crimes, gather evidence, and prepare reports for prosecution. Requires strong investigative skills and adherence to legal procedures.
Probation Officer Supervise offenders released from prison, assess risk, and support rehabilitation. Requires strong communication and risk assessment skills within the criminal justice system.
